准備配置數據 拿到集群 api server 地址 拿到集群 ca 證書 創建具有集群管理權限的 ServiceAccount 並拿到其 token,比如這里用戶名是 k8s-admin 配置 kubectl 設置之前拿到的 api server 地址與 ca 證書(先將證書 ...
背景:我們通過會有多個k s集群,例如集群 cn k s 和集群 jp k s ,那個就需要有一台服務器可以同時訪問兩個集群,方式:將 個集群的config信息存放到一個文件中,通過使用kubectl config use contextcontext name 來訪問集群。簡而言之,通過設置context來讓kubectl訪問不同的k s集群。 具體步驟如下: 假如已經准備好 個集群的配置文件, ...
2019-09-30 16:35 0 1947 推薦指數:
准備配置數據 拿到集群 api server 地址 拿到集群 ca 證書 創建具有集群管理權限的 ServiceAccount 並拿到其 token,比如這里用戶名是 k8s-admin 配置 kubectl 設置之前拿到的 api server 地址與 ca 證書(先將證書 ...
集群部署在雲服務器的ECS上,但是有時需要本地原創連接集群,這就需要通過ApiServer的外網地址去訪問集群,但是~/.kube/config下的地址又都是內網,所以可以使用如下方式解決: Mac安裝kubectl 找到服務器 ...
前言 Kubectl 是一個命令行接口,用於對 Kubernetes 集群運行命令。Kubectl 在 $HOME/.kube 目錄中尋找一個名為 config 的文件。你可以通過設置環境變量 KUBECONFIG 或設置 --kubeconfig 參數指定其它 kubeconfig 文件 ...
[root@master ~]# kubectl get nodes 查看集群節點NAME STATUS AGEnode1 Ready 25mnode2 Ready 19m[root@master ~]# kubectl version 查看版本 ...
配置,可通過獲取集群狀態來檢查kubectl是否正確配置: 如果出現:The connectio ...
之前訪問k8s都是通過token進去dashboard,如下所示。但是現在希望通過kubectl訪問k8s,所以還需要進一步的配置。 1. 安裝kubectl命令行工具,配置環境變量,環境變量的值指向配置文件,配置文件可以有多個(我的配置文件有兩個,如下所示) 2. 根據官方文檔 ...
添加一個連接 kubernetes 集群的憑據。 3、配置kubernetes ...
k8s集群-node節點上執行kubectl 由於各種原因,需要在node上執行kubectl。 kubectl get nodes The connection to the server localhost:8080 was refused - did you specify ...